TWO people have appeared in court charged with causing the death of a man on a Barrow-bound train.

An investigation was launched after David Clark, 56, suffered a fatal cardiac arrest on board a train at Silverdale railway station.

The Northern service was travelling between Preston and Barrow.

Nicola Cavin, 22, from Market Street, Grange, and David Noble, 32, of Main Street, also Grange, denied unlawfully killing Mr Clark.

Police and paramedics were called to Silverdale station shortly before 9.30pm on March 2 last year.

The train was evacuated and Mr Clark was taken to hospital where he died on the following morning.

The defendants are expected to appear for their trial at Preston Crown Court on May 26.

Mr Clark’s family paid tribute to him at the time.

“David was a very popular character in the local community,” they said. “One thing that we have been shown through this tragedy is that David will be so sadly missed by his many friends.”
